Senior Mobile App Developer

Object Data Inc.

View all jobs of this company

Vacancy

5

Job Context

Job Responsibilities

  • Minimum 8+ years of Software development experience
  • 5+ years of experience in designing, building, and implementing mobile application solutions in Android and/or iOS.
  • Demonstrable portfolio of released applications on the Apple App store and/or the Google Play store
  • For Android need to be Experienced with Java/Kotlin, Google Play Services, Android Studio, AndroidX, Jetpack, Android Architecture Component, ROOM, RxJava, RxKotlin, Xml layouts & Cloud Messaging API
  • For iOS need to be Experienced with Swift, SwiftUI, CoreData, Uikit, Foundation, CoreGraphics, CoreAnimation, Storekit, URLSession, AFNetwork, CocoaPods, AVFoundation, Xcode
  • Knowledge of UI and animation frameworks, touch user interface, and MVP/MVVM/VIPER application design patterns.
  • In-depth knowledge of at least one of the following cross-platform mobile application development tool: React Native, Flutter, Xamarin, Ionic, or Appcelerator is a MUST.
  • Deep foundation in computer science with a strong understanding in data structures, and algorithms
  • Familiarity with OOP design principles
  • Working knowledge of database concepts and SQL
  • Working knowledge of HTML, CSS, JavaScript is required
  • Solid knowledge working with Restful APIs and large datasets

Employment Status

Full-time

Workplace

  • Work from home, Work at office

Educational Requirements

  • Bachelor’s degree in Computer Science, Information Technology, Engineering, or related field is a MUST
  • Skills Required: , Android Application Development (MVC/MVP/MVVM/MVI), Java/Kotlin, Google Play Services, Android Studio, AndroidX, Jetpack, Android Architecture Component, ROOM, RxJava, RxKotlin, Xml layouts & Cloud Messaging API, Apple App store, Google Play store, ionic framework, iOS Application Development, Objective C, React Native
  • Skills Required: Appcelerator, Cloud Messaging API, Google Play Service, RESTful API, SQL, UI Animation, XML Layouts

Read More:_Senior Mobile App Developer

Experience Requirements

  • At least 6 year(s)
  • The applicants should have experience in the following area(s):
    Android application development, Android Studio, AndroidX, Google Play store, Java kotlin, jetpack, MVVM, React and React Native, RxJava, RxKotlin

Additional Requirements

  • Age 29 to 44 years
  • Excellent communication skills in English (written & spoken). MUST be fluent in English.
  • Good interpersonal skills required to interact with clients, technical staff, and third parties.
  • Software development experience with a US/European company/environment is highly desirable.

Job Location

United States

Salary

Compensation & Other Benefits

  • Performance bonus, Weekly 2 holidays
  • Salary Review: Yearly
  • Competitive salary
  • Regular working hours: 8 hours/day, 5 days a week
  • 15 days paid leave per year

Job Source

Bdjobs.com Online Job Posting.

Leave a Reply

Your email address will not be published. Required fields are marked *